Schnitzerbräu ist glutenfrei. Es werden hierfür ausschließlich von Natur aus glutenfreie Rohstoffe und bestes Hirsemalz aus Bio-Anbau verwendet. Damit Schnitzerbräu auch wirklich glutenfrei ist, werden keine anderen Biere auf der Anlage gebraut.

330 ml bottle. Pours a slightly hazy, very pale yellow with a small white head. Sweet aroma with wheat, yeast, malt and light hay. Sweet flavour of wheat, malt, citrus and yeast with a mildly dry, bitter finish. Light body with an oily texture and fizzy carbonation.

Die Farbe ist hell orange, der Geruch etwas penetrant süßlich, wie eine Limonade. Grapefruit oder Zitrone. Der Antrunk ist wässrig-neutral. Zum Hauptteil hin kommt eine citrusähnliche Süße zum Vorschein, die sich für meinen Geschmack penetrant vor alle anderen Aromen setzt. Zum Abgang hin ist eine angenehme Herbe spürbar, die sich auch relativ lange auf der Zunge hält. Insgesamt ist mir das Bier aber zu fruchtig-zitronig.

330ml bottle. Clear yellow gold colour, frothy white foam head leaving some lacing and bubblegum aroma with yeasty, vanilla & banana notes. Watery sweet fruity bubblegum-like flavour with a light bitterness. Light bodied, soft to medium carbonation, dryish finish.
